Study Summary
The purpose of this study is to determine how well our dHPT (Dehydrated Human Placental Tissue) Product and Standard of Care work when compared to Standard of Care alone in achieving complete closure of diabetic foot.

Full Details on ClinicalTrials.gov ↗What the Registry Record Tells You About NCT07014176
The ClinicalTrials.gov registry entry for NCT07014176 describes a study currently listed as recruiting, categorized as Phase 4. The registered enrollment target is 120 participants, a figure that helps gauge the scale of data the investigators plan to collect, below the 253-participant average among 67 other Diabetic Foot Ulcer trials with a reported enrollment target (53% lower). The listed sponsor is Cellution Biologics, which has 2 total studies on file at ClinicalTrials.gov.
The record links to 1 condition, with Diabetic Foot Ulcer appearing as the primary indexed condition, and to 2 interventions - of which Amnion-Intermediate-Chorion is the first listed.
NCT07014176 reports 8 study locations spanning 6 distinct geographic areas - top geographies include North Carolina, Pennsylvania, California.
